""A Guide to Telepathy and Psychometry"" by S.G.J. Ouseley is a comprehensive book that explores the fascinating world of psychic abilities. The author provides a detailed explanation of telepathy, which is the ability to communicate with others through thoughts and feelings, and psychometry, which is the ability to read information from objects through touch. The book begins by discussing the history and science behind telepathy and psychometry, including the different types of telepathy and how psychometry works. The author also explores the various ways in which these abilities can be developed and enhanced through meditation, visualization, and other techniques.Throughout the book, Ouseley provides practical exercises and techniques for readers to try on their own, as well as real-life examples of telepathy and psychometry in action. He also discusses the ethical considerations involved in using these abilities, including the importance of respecting others' privacy and boundaries.Overall, ""A Guide to Telepathy and Psychometry"" is an informative and engaging book that offers a valuable introduction to the fascinating world of psychic abilities.
